Business
Theon International PLC develops and manufactures customizable electro-optic night vision and thermal imaging systems primarily for military and security applications. Its main products include night vision monoculars and binoculars; family of night vision sights; clip-on night sights; night driver’s viewers; digital day and night cameras; upgrade kits for armored vehicles; thermal stand-alone and clip-on uncooled sights; vehicle and platform-based thermal imaging systems; and various optical and mechanical customized designs with integrated logistics support and maintenance services. The company operates globally with a significant commercial presence in over 70 countries, including 26 NATO members, supported by production facilities and offices in Athens, Germany, Singapore, Abu Dhabi, and other locations. Founded in 1997 and headquartered in Athens, Greece, Theon International is listed on Euronext Amsterdam (Ticker: THEON.AS) and has delivered over 200,000 systems to armed forces worldwide. Recent major developments include Theon's strategic acquisition of a 9.8% stake in French electro-optical technology firm Exosens SA, making it the largest strategic investor and reinforcing collaboration especially in production and delivery coordination through 2030. The company is expanding its A.R.M.E.D. product ecosystem with new launches such as THEA Heads-Up Display (helmet-mounted for enhanced situational awareness), IRIS-C Thermal Clip-On (fusion capability with night vision goggles), and ORION fused binoculars. Strategic partnerships and investments in 2025 include cooperation with KOPIN Corporation for augmented reality system development, a long-term supply agreement with eMagin Corporation for OLED displays, and an industrial partnership with ALEREON for wireless communication technologies. Theon also recently acquired a 30% stake in ShockEOS, enhancing its multi-sensor gimbal capabilities. These moves accompany efforts to strengthen supply chain agreements with key suppliers and expand its footprint in the US, Middle East, and Far East markets. The company targets platform-based and man-portable advanced electro-optic systems integrating cutting-edge sensor fusion and augmented reality capabilities to support battlefield awareness and operational effectiveness. Theon International's revenue growth is supported by a €654 million soft order backlog with a strong adjusted EBIT margin exceeding 25%, reflecting solid operational performance. The acquisition and investment activities align with its strategy to lead globally in night vision and thermal imaging technologies while evolving to integrated soldier systems leveraging digital and augmented reality solutions. Overall, Theon International PLC operates as an OEM controlling all aspects of its product technology, emphasizing innovation, customization, and mission-critical defense optics. The company's footprint covers Europe, North America, the Middle East, and Asia, with ongoing expansion plans, particularly in the US and NATO markets, supported by robust financial health and strategic industry alliances.
